About This Novel

Jasper, a 13-year-old boy, has the special ability of synesthesia. Everything is a color and shape in his eyes, even words have colors and shapes. The world in his eyes is as colorful and wonderful as a kaleidoscope, but at the same time he suffers from autism and prosopagnosia. He cannot recognize the features of human faces, and he cannot even recognize his father. A woman named Bea Rackham disappeared. She was Jasper's neighbor across the street, but Jasper claimed that he had killed her: he had stabbed her to death after a conflict with her in the Rackham's kitchen. When the police investigated and collected evidence, they found signs of cleaning at the scene. Jasper's father actually told the police that he knew nothing about Bea's disappearance. This disappearance has become suspicious because of Jasper's prosopagnosia and his father's concealment. At this moment, Bea Rackham's body was discovered by the police... Who is the real murderer? Is it Jasper, Jasper's dad, or someone else? Will Jasper's prosopagnosia be an obstacle to catching the real murderer? Why would dad lie to the police? What horrifying story is hidden behind this murder?
